No, there is no direct bus from Dunstable to Halifax. However, there are services departing from Church Street and arriving at Godley Bridge via Luton Station Interchange, Milton Keynes Coachway and Leeds City Bus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 8h.
No, there is no direct train from Dunstable to Halifax. However, there are services departing from Leagrave and arriving at Halifax via King's Cross and Leeds.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 52m.
The distance between Dunstable and Halifax is 236 miles. The road distance is 162.6 miles.
